Case Study: Construct an artistic piece that reflects on deviance through two major perspectives - positivism and constructionism. When you think about deviance, ask yourself, "what am I trying to explain?"

The positivist and the constructionist perspectives are asking different questions regarding deviance. the central fact about deviance: it is created by society. I do not mean this in the way it is ordinarily understood, in which the causes of deviance are located in the social situation of the deviant or in "social factors" which prompt his action. I mean, rather, that social groups create deviance by making the rules whose infraction constitutes deviance, and by applying those rules to particular people and labeling them as outsiders. From this point of view, deviance is not a quality of the act the person commits, but rather a consequence of the application by others of rules and sanctions to an "offender." The deviant is one to whom that label has successfully been applied; deviant behavior is behavior people.
